JUMBO OATMEAL-RAISIN COOKIES 0 Picture

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ter, room temperature
  • 3/4 cup packed light brown sugar
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 tsp vanilla
  • 2 1/2 cups rolled oats
  • 2 cups raisins
  • 1 cup sweetened shredded coconut

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, and salt; set aside.

With an electric mixer, cream butter and sugars until light and fluffy. Beat in eggs and vanilla, scraping down sides of bowl as needed. Add flour mixture; beat just until combined. Add oats, raisins, and coconut; beat just until combined.

Drop level 1/4-cup measures of dough, 1/2 inches apart, onto baking sheets.

Bake until cookies have spread and are golden brown and soft to the touch, 18 to 20 minutes, rotating sheets halfway through. Cool 6 minutes on sheets. Trans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
